Settlement procedure: Commission may accept, seek revision, or reject applications and resume inquiry if timelines lapse. A complete Settlement Application must be placed before the Commission within seven working days; the inquiry stays in abeyance while under consideration. The Commission may request revisions, seek objections, and either accept the proposal and close proceedings under sub-section (3) of section 48A subject to implementation and monitoring terms, or reject and resume the inquiry under section 26. The Commission will communicate the computed Settlement Amount for acceptance and payment within prescribed periods, conclude settlement within 180 working days (subject to extension), and may reject applications for non-response or breach of undertakings, after affording a hearing where required.
